NetApp (NTAP) has been consistently demonstrating a strong performance on the stock market, gaining 94% since the end of fiscal year 2020 due to favorable shifts in the P/S multiple. High volume trades on NetApp call options have been observed, while insiders like CEO George Kurian and President Cesar Cernuda have sold significant shares. However, this hasnβt dampened investor sentiment substantially, with NetApp showing promising growth and strong post-earnings performance. Its second-quarter earnings for fiscal year 2025 were impressive, showing
record margins and increased growth in flash storage. This performance has led to raised earnings predictions and stock optimism. The company has also advanced in
AI innovations, potentially driving revenue growth by 2025. Analyst upgrades from JPMorgan to Overweight suggest positive future performance, despite occasional stock movement dips. Nascent partnerships with
AWS Outposts and
Google Cloud highlight NetApp's commitment to
hybrid cloud solutions, offering investors scalable, high-performance data infrastructure options. Concerns have been raised about insider selling, but overall, NetAppβs achievements and potential make it an attractive investment.
